Director of Hammam Al-Alil District, Khaled Al-Tahtah, revealed that advanced rates of completion have been achieved in the model school construction projects within the Chinese loan program .

Al-Tahtah said, “Work is underway to build 3 model schools in the Hammam Al-Alil district, as part of the Chinese loan funded by the General Secretariat of the Council of Ministers .”

He pointed out that “the schools are located in Palestine neighborhood, Al-Omrini village, and Al-Jurn village, where the completion rate of these projects has reached advanced stages of 90%, 95%, and 98%, respectively .”

Al-Tahtah added, “These schools will contribute to improving the educational process in the region, and will also help in solving the bottlenecks that other schools suffer from,” indicating that “these projects are part of the national plan to develop the educational infrastructure in Nineveh Governorate .”

It is noteworthy that these projects come within a broader series of educational projects implemented in Nineveh Governorate, which aim to support the educational process and improve the school environment for students.
